Understanding renters lawyers

Renters lawyers are legal professionals who specialize in providing legal representation and support to tenants. They possess in-depth knowledge of landlord-tenant laws and regulations, and they serve as advocates for renters who find themselves in legal disputes or facing unfair treatment. With their expertise, renters lawyers strive to ensure that tenants are treated fairly, their rights are upheld, and they have access to adequate housing.

A Legal Ally in Landlord-Tenant Disputes

Renters lawyers are particularly valuable in resolving landlord-tenant disputes. These disputes often involve issues such as discrimination, eviction, security deposits, lease disputes, repair and maintenance concerns, and illegal actions by the landlord. When tenants face such challenges, renters lawyers can provide professional guidance, negotiate on their behalf, and, if required, represent them in court proceedings.

For example, if a landlord attempts an unjust eviction, a renters lawyer can step in and investigate whether proper eviction procedures were followed. They can then craft a strong legal defense for the tenant, protecting their right to remain in their home. Renters lawyers understand the intricacies of eviction laws and can help tenants navigate the complex legal processes, presenting the strongest possible case.

Ensuring Fair Housing Practices

Discrimination is an unfortunate reality that some tenants face. Whether it is based on race, gender, disability, or any other protected characteristic, discrimination in housing is illegal and intolerable. Renters lawyers actively work to combat such discrimination by holding landlords accountable for their actions.

By working with renters lawyers, tenants can address discriminatory practices, file complaints with relevant agencies, and seek justice for any harm they have experienced. Renters lawyers are well-versed in fair housing laws and understand how to gather evidence, build a case, and pursue legal action against landlords who engage in discriminatory practices.

Securing Safe and Habitabable Housing

One of the most critical functions of renters lawyers is to ensure that tenants have access to safe and habitable housing. They act as watchdogs, ensuring that landlords meet their legal obligations to provide proper maintenance, repairs, and adherence to building and safety codes.

When tenants face issues such as leaks, infestations, mold, or other health hazards, renters lawyers can step in to protect their well-being. They can communicate with landlords, demanding necessary repairs or remediation. If the landlord fails to respond, renters lawyers can escalate the matter to seek legal remedies, such as rent abatement or even initiating a lawsuit.
